Description

The multi-circuit protection valve serves a critical role in the pneumatic brake system of heavy commercial vehicles, ensuring that pressure stability is maintained across different circuits. This component is designed with heavy-duty grade materials to withstand constant pressure fluctuations and maintain the integrity of the braking system during operation.

303.02.0061-S is the OE-equivalent of the KNORR-BREMSE AE 4527 S multi-circuit protection valve used in heavy commercial vehicle braking systems. This part is engineered for precise performance and is fully compatible with the specified KNORR-BREMSE hardware to ensure seamless integration within the pneumatic circuit.

For workshop technicians, this valve offers a reliable solution for routine maintenance and system repairs. When replacing or installing this component, it is essential to ensure all connections are secure and that the pneumatic lines are free from contaminants to maintain optimal pressure regulation and system longevity.

FAQ

What is the primary function of the 303.02.0061-S valve?
The 303.02.0061-S acts as a multi-circuit protection valve, ensuring that pressure in one circuit does not negatively affect others in the braking system.
Which OEM codes is this part compatible with?
This product is a direct replacement/equivalent for the KNORR-BREMSE AE 4527 S (AE4527S) part number.
